I don’t think I have the gift to sign another artist under me – Tiwa Savage

- Advertisement -

Tiwa Savage, a renowned Nigerian music icon, has revealed that she has no intentions of signing another artist under her wing. In an interview with Forbes Africa, she explained that managing talents can be stressful and cited examples of artists causing trouble even when she is not actively engaged in their careers.

Instead of signing artists, Tiwa Savage expressed her desire to support upcoming musicians by creating a music school. She believes that providing a platform for aspiring artists to learn and grow before signing with a label will be more beneficial in the long run.

In addition to her personal success, Tiwa Savage emphasized the importance of African artists taking ownership of their art and industry. She urged artists to control their publishing, labels, and narratives, rather than seeking validation from foreign markets.

Furthermore, Tiwa Savage advised emerging artists to focus on building a strong foundation before rushing to fame. She highlighted the pressures of success, such as streams, concerts, and obligations, and stressed the importance of staying true to oneself amidst external influences.

Lastly, Tiwa Savage challenged the industry to invest in building a self-sufficient music ecosystem rather than trying to break into foreign markets. She believes that with the right infrastructure, affordable data, and investment, African artists can create a thriving industry that others will aspire to be a part of.
